Rome, Armed to the Teeth
"He Lives by the Law - Tanzi's Law!"
Originally released in 1976. Rome, Armed to the Teeth is a action/crime film. directed by Umberto Lenzi.
Starring Maurizio Merli, Arthur Kennedy, and Tomas Milian
Synopsis
A tough, violent cop who doesn't mind bending the law goes after a machine-gun-carrying, hunchbacked psychotic killer.
